The ILS Engineer is responsible for planning and delivering the logistics support framework that ensures complex systems are operationally available, maintainable, and cost-effective throughout their lifecycle. You'll work closely with engineering, sustainment, and stakeholder teams to embed supportability into system design from the outset.

Under the direction of a designated Team leader, our team performs the following functions as individual assignments or as part of a team:

  • Develop and maintain ILS documentation, including Supportability Analysis, Logistics Support Analysis (LSA), and Maintenance Plans.
  • Conduct Reliability, Availability, and Maintainability (RAM) analysis and Life Cycle Costing (LCC).
  • Define and manage provisioning, spares, and technical data requirements.
  • Support codification, configuration management, and obsolescence planning.
  • Collaborate with Systems Engineers and OEMs to integrate supportability into system design.
  • Engage with stakeholders to ensure compliance with sustainment frameworks and standards.
  • Contribute to ILS workshops, reviews, and assurance activities.
